What is a Fishbone Diagram?

A fishbone diagram, also known as a cause and effect diagram, is a graphical tool used in quality improvement methods. It is designed to identify and organize the possible causes of a problem or a specific outcome. The diagram takes its name from its shape, which resembles the skeletal structure of a fish, with the problem or outcome at the head and the causes branching out like fishbones.

Understanding the Purpose

The fishbone diagram is utilized to visualize the cause and effect relationships that contribute to a particular problem. It helps break down complex issues into manageable components and allows teams to identify the root causes more effectively. By visualizing the causes in a systematic way, it promotes a better understanding of the relationships between different elements and assists in generating potential solutions.

Components of a Fishbone Diagram

A typical fishbone diagram consists of the following components:

1. Head: The head of the fish represents the problem or effect that needs to be addressed.
2. Spine: The spine of the fish represents the main cause category that contributes to the problem. Common categories include people, process, materials, equipment, and environment.
3. Branches: The branches stemming from the spine represent the sub-categories of causes within each main category.
4. Bones: The bones of the fish represent the specific causes or factors that contribute to the sub-categories. These can be brainstormed and added to the diagram as individual bones.

Creating a Fishbone Diagram

To create a fishbone diagram, follow these steps:

1. Define the problem or effect you want to analyze and write it in the head of the fish.
2. Identify the main cause categories related to the problem, such as people, process, materials, equipment, or environment. Draw these as branches from the spine.
3. Brainstorm and list potential causes within each main category, representing them as bones branching out from their respective sub-categories.
4. Analyze and refine the diagram, ensuring that all possible causes are considered and connected properly.
5. Once completed, review the diagram with the team, prioritize the most likely causes, and develop strategies to address them.

Benefits of Using a Fishbone Diagram

The fishbone diagram offers several advantages, including:

1. Visual representation: The diagram provides a clear and visual representation of the multiple causes related to a problem, enabling teams to grasp the complexity of the issue.
2. Brainstorming tool: It facilitates brainstorming sessions by helping team members identify all potential causes and generate ideas for improvement.
3. Root cause analysis: The diagram aids in identifying the root causes by visually displaying the relationship between different causes.
4. Team collaboration: It promotes collaboration among team members by encouraging diverse perspectives and collective problem-solving.
5. Process improvement: By highlighting the causes of a problem, the fishbone diagram guides teams in developing strategies to improve processes and prevent future issues.

In conclusion, a fishbone diagram is a valuable tool in quality improvement methods that helps teams identify and analyze the causes of a problem or outcome. By visually representing the cause and effect relationships, it facilitates brainstorming, root cause analysis, and collaboration, ultimately leading to effective problem-solving and process improvement.
